Transaction bf786650fe6384312a765fa2ac296958ca40140ff5047046d90c788f636fbe47

3 Input
2 Outputs
  • bf786650fe6384312a765fa2ac296958ca40140ff5047046d90c788f636fbe47:0
  • value  5966517
    address  3AouriKd6i45dtyVXnGq6QLFkwCmB6TbVc
  • bf786650fe6384312a765fa2ac296958ca40140ff5047046d90c788f636fbe47:1
  • value  268266900
    address  15pyD36diUWSaPesEnuxczQas7EMu4WJ5H